LA Bantam - Strangers In Flight

I was fortunate recently to buy one of the nine books with a very uncommon illustrated cover published by Bantam Publications of Los Angeles. Their 28th book is Mignon G. Eberhart's Strangers In Flight.

In common with all but one of LA Bantam's books Strangers In Flight is 100 pages long and is 110 mm (4 5/16") wide by 152 mm (6") tall. Cover and pages are made from high acid pulp paper. The page collation is:

[1] title page,
[2] copyright page,
3-100 Strangers In Flight.

The book has a 1940 copyright date and states that the story was published in the November, 1940 McCall's Magazine. The back cover lists books 21 through 27.

In common with most LA Bantams there are variant covers. In addition to the illustrated version shown below there are strong yellowish green/light blue and strong yellowish green/light orange yellow text only versions.
